#e1c6ff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e1c6ff is composed of 88.2% red, 77.6% green and 100%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.8% cyan, 22.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 268.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 88.8%. #e1c6ff color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c38dff.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

Shades and Tints of #e1c6ff

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#f6edff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e1c6ff

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e2e0e5 is the less saturated color, while #e1c6ff is the most saturated one.
